Aspects to Consider When Choosing Back Door Installers
To ensure that the installation of your back entrance is managed properly, it's crucial to carefully consider your alternatives. Here are some elements to bear in mind when picking reliable back entrance installers:
1. Experience and Expertise
- Look for installers who have a solid credibility in your community and comprehensive experience in door installation. They should be familiar with different types of doors, including steel, fiberglass, and wood.
2. Licenses and Insurance
- Any reputable installer must be appropriately licensed and insured. This safeguards you from liability in case of mishaps and guarantees that the work meets necessary local building codes.
3. Client Reviews and References
- Examine online reviews on platforms like Google and Yelp. You can also request references from previous clients to get firsthand accounts of their experiences.
4. Service Offerings
- Ensure that the installer uses a detailed series of services, consisting of door alternatives, custom fitting, and post-installation service, such as upkeep or repair work.
5. Pricing
- While it can be appealing to choose the most affordable bid, concentrate on value for cash. Quality setups often come at a higher price, however this generally equates to durability and dependability.
6. Professionalism and Communication
- Evaluate the installer's responsiveness and professionalism throughout your preliminary interactions. Effective interaction is crucial for an effective job.
7. Extra Services
- Some installers might provide additional services, such as door security enhancements or custom painting and staining to match your home's aesthetic appeals.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. For how long does it take to set up a back entrance?
The installation time varies depending upon the kind of door and the intricacy of the task, however generally, a professional installer can complete the job in a few hours.
2. What kind of door is best for a back entry?
Fiberglass doors are popular for back entries due to their resilience and energy efficiency. Nevertheless, wood doors can offer visual appeal, while steel doors provide boosted security.
3. Can I install a back door myself?
While it is possible, employing a professional is a good idea for optimal results. Do it yourself installations may lead to errors, impacting the door's efficiency and longevity.
4. What should I look for in a quote?
An in-depth quote must consist of the cost of the door, labor, cleanup, and any extra materials needed for installation. Prevent quotes that appear uncommonly low, as they may stint quality.
5. How can I look after my new back door?
Routine upkeep, such as cleansing and checking weather condition removing, can extend the life of your door. Think about using a sealant or paint to protect it from the aspects if it's made from wood.
